Output 34aef91ccc96f3e9a22dbfb265e0c933aec190bffd55306d9441ad86b83cfd6d:50

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 caf588f3e079596117d9b847f911f2367ee2969d2bc29316cba1abe8a451675c
address
tb1pet6c3ulq09vkz97ehprljy0jxelw995a90pfx9kt5x473fz3vawqexdldm
transaction
34aef91ccc96f3e9a22dbfb265e0c933aec190bffd55306d9441ad86b83cfd6d